1.The expression of serum squamous cell carcinoma antigen in patients with common skin diseases
Journal of Medical Postgraduates 2015;(6):622-624
Objective There is a significant increase of squamous cell carcinoma antigen ( SCCA) in patients with common skin diseases .The aim of this study was to investigate the difference expression of serum SCCA in patients with common skin diseases . Methods A total of 497 patients with 14 kinds of common skin diseases from the Department of Dermatology were recruited , and the serum SCCA was measured . Results The positive rates of SCCA in 116 patients with psoriasis and 37 patients with erythroderma were 90 .5% and 100%, respectively .The common skin diseases with positive rate of SCCA greater than 60% includes eczema (61.7%), generalized dermatitis (65.1%),pemphigus (61.1%), bullous pemphigoid (62.2%).The SCCA values in pustulosa (1.76 ±1.22 ng/mL) and arthropathica psoriasis (1.69 ±1.05 ng/mL) were decreased compared with pustular (2.86 ±1.46 ng/mL) and arthropathica psoriasis (3.56 ±1.84 ng/mL) (P<0.05). Conclusion The SCCA value may have a relationship with the increase of the performance of keratinization and desquamation in the skin diseases , and it could be used as a valuable indicator for the diagnosis and treatment in patients with cutaneous diseases .
2.Observation of the Efficacy of Astragalus Injection in Skin of Aging Mice Induced by D-galactose
Journal of China Medical University 2015;44(8):721-724
Objective To investigate the efficacy of acupoint injection of Astragalus on contents of SOD,HYP and MDA in skin of aging mice in-duced by D-galactose. Methods The mice were randomly divided into normal group,model group,Astragalus group,and saline group(n=15). Except for the normal control group,the mice of other groups were treated with continuous subcutaneous injection of D-galactose to establish mice ag-ing model. The Astragalus group mice was injected with 0.01mL Astragalus in Sanzuli acupoint per day,The saline group mice received an injection of same amount of saline. SOD,HYP and MDA changes in the skin tissue and serum were evaluated after 21 days. Results All the index in the skin tissue and serum showed significant difference(P<0.01)between model group mice and normal control group. Compared with model group,SOD activity and MDA content in the skin tissue and serum of the Astragalus group mice were significantly raised,HYP content was significantly reduced (P<0.01). There also were significant differences of these index between the saline group mice and the model group(P<0.05),but the effect was not as good as the Astragalus group mice. Conclusion Acupoint Injection of Astragalus can prevent and protect against skin aging induced by D-galactose.
3.Health examination results of primary or middle school teachers
Yanni XIA ; Haiwei JIANG ; Yongmei CHEN ; Panpan DENG
Chinese Journal of Health Management 2009;3(2):92-94
Objective To investigate health status of primary or middle school teachers. Methods A total of 4482 physical examination results of the teachers from Qiaokou District of Wuhan in 2008 were compared with 5526 data obtained in 2006. The rate of healthy to unhealthy participants was evaluated. The overall and age-specific disease incidence, including overweight, hypertension, hyperlipidmia, hyperglycemia,liver dysfunction, abnormal EGG, concrement, adiposis hepatica, and HBV infection, was recorded. X2 test was used for statistical analysis. Results Abnormal examination results were more common in 2008 when compared with those in 2006( X2 = 28. 35, P < 0. 05 ). The incidence of hypertension was descended ( X2 =4. 51 ,P < 0. 05 ), although the rates of hyperlipidimia, hyperglycemia, liver dysfunction, abnormal ECG,concrement, and adiposis hepatica were increased in 2008 ( P < 0. 05 ). The incidence of hyperlipidimia, liver dysfunction, abnormal ECG, and adiposis hepatica increased in all age groups ( P < 0. 05 ). The incidence of hyperglycemia and concrement increased in those > 35 years old ( P < 0. 05 ). Conclusion Except for hypertension and HBV infection, the incidence of common diseases has been increased in the young and middle-aged teachers during the last 2 years. Thus the health management for the primary or middle school teacher should be improved in the future.
4.Efficacy and Safety of Nedaplatin or Cisplatin Combined with Paclitaxel in the Treatment of Advanced Lung Cancer and Esophageal Cancer:A Systematic Review
Yongmei HU ; Haoling ZHANG ; Xia HE ; Min CHEN
China Pharmacy 2016;27(24):3397-3399,3400
OBJECTIVE:To systematically review the efficacy and safety of nedaplatin or cisplatin combined with paclitaxel in the treatment of advanced non-small cell lung cancer(NSCLC)and esophageal cancer. METHOD:Retrieved from PubMed,CJFD and Wanfang Database,randomized controlled trials(RCT)about nedaplatin combined with paclitaxel(TN)or cisplatin combined with paclitaxel (TP) in the treatment of advanced NSCLC and esophageal cancer were collected. Meta-analysis was performed by using Rev Man 5.3 software after data extract and quality evaluation. RESULTS:Totally 7 RCTs were included,involving 505 pa-tients. Results of Meta-analysis showed,there were no significant differences in the short-term efficacy [NSCLC:OR=1.08,95%CI (0.66,1.75),P=0.76;esophageal cancer:OR=1.44,95%CI(0.68,3.06),P=0.34],1-year survival rate [NSCLC:OR=1.21, 95%CI(0.60,2.44),P=0.59],2-year survival rate [NSCLC:OR=1.01,95%CI(0.38,2.68),P=0.99],the incidence ofⅢ/Ⅳleuko-penia [esophageal cancer:OR=1.36,95%CI(0.62,2.96),P=0.44],incidence ofⅢ/Ⅳthrombocytopenia [NSCLC:OR=1.37,95%CI(0.64,2.92),P=0.42;esophageal cancer:OR=0.97,95%CI(0.30,3.18),P=0.96] and incidence of Ⅲ/Ⅳ neutropenia [NSCLC:OR=1.38,95%CI(0.70,2.74),P=0.35]. Compared with TP,TN can significantly reduce the incidences of nausea and vomiting [NSCLC:OR=0.34,95%CI(0.20,0.60),P<0.001;esophageal cancer:OR=0.16,95%CI(0.07,0.35),P<0.001] and nephrotox-icity [esophageal cancer:OR=0.10,95%CI(0.02,0.55),P=0.009]. CONCLUSIONS:Both TN and TP show good efficacy in the treatment of NSCLC,but TN has lower incidences of astrointestinal reactions and nephrotoxicity.
5.Survey and control of extensively drug-resistant Acinetobacter baumannii infection outbreak in a basic-level hospital
Li REN ; Xia LEI ; Xin ZHANG ; Yongmei ZHAO
Chinese Journal of Infection Control 2015;(6):370-373
Objective To survey and control an extensively drug-resistant Acinetobacter baumannii (A.bauman-nii)(XDRAB)lower respiratory tract infection (LRTI)outbreak in intensive care unit (ICU)of a hospital. Methods From October 27,2013 to December 27,2013,5 cases of XDRAB LRTI occurred in ICU,epidemiological investigation was conducted,sources and transmission routes of infection were searched,intervention measures were performed.Results XDRAB were isolated from patients’sputum and environmental object surface,drug-resistant spectrums of isolated XDRAB were almost the same,suggesting the outbreak was due to the contamination of envi-ronment by the same pathogen.54 specimens were taken before disinfection,26 were positive,XDRAB were isola-ted from door handles,sheets and telephones.Investigation concluded that the outbreak of XDRAB infection was due to contamination of indoor environment and equipment,incomplete disinfection,and inadequate hand hygiene compliance of health care workers.After the implementation of a series of control measures,XDRAB was not found,and there was no new XDRAB infection cases.Conclusion Environment contamination is the main cause of this XDRAB healthcare-associated infection(HAI)outbreak,strict implementation of isolation,prevention and con-trol measures of MDROs can effectively control HAI outbreak caused by A.baumannii.
6.A control study on levosimendan in treatment of refractory heart failure complicating severe renal insufficiency
Yongmei LI ; Xiangqing ZHENG ; Xia MEI ; Feifei WU ; Yuhui LUO
Chongqing Medicine 2016;45(33):4675-4677
Objective To studythe efficacy of levosimendan in treating refractory heart failure complicating severe renal in sufficiency.Methods Sixty-seven cases of refractory heart failure complicating severe renal insufficiency in the internal medicine department of our hospital were randomly divided into the levosimendan treatment group(L group,n=33)and dopamine treatment group(D group,n=34).The changes of N-terminal pro-B-type natriuretic peptide(NT-pro-BNP),left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F)and glomerular filtration rate(GFR)before treatment and on 1,3,7,30 d after treatment were compared between the two groups and analyzed.Results Before the treatment,there were no statistically significant differences in the baseline indicators between the two groups(P>0.05).The group L:the NT-pro-BNP level on 1,3,7 d after treatment was decreased significantly(P< 0.05),LVEF on 3,7 d was significantly increased compared with th baseline(P<0.05)and GFR on 1,3,7,30 d was significantly increased compared with the baseline(P<0.05).The group D:the NT-pro-BNP level on 7 d of treatment was significantly decreased(P<0.05),LVEF on 7 d of treatment was significantly increased compared with the baseline(P<0.05),and no statistically significant changes were observed in GFR on 1,3,7,30 d(P>0.05).After treatment,NT-pro-BNP,LVEF and GFR significant level values in the group L were better than those in the group D.Conclusion Levosimendan is superior to dopamine in improving heart and renal function for the patients with refractory heart failure complicating severe renal insufficiency.
7.The effect of isosteviol on growth of human osteosarcoma cell lines U-2OS
Xiaoxia WANG ; Jue ZHANG ; Jian LI ; Yongmei XIA ; Hong PAN
China Oncology 2016;26(3):230-237
Background and purpose:Osteosarcoma, a highly malignant bone tumor, develops rapidly. The current medicines for osteosarcoma present some limitations with serious side effects of long-term use. Isosteviol has the structure of tetracyclic diterpene which is the starting material of many anti-cancer drugs. However, its anti-tumor activity has been rarely reported. This study investigated the effect of isosteviol on proliferation of human osteosarcoma cell line U-2OS.Methods:The effect of isosteviol on U-2OS cell proliferation was assayed by MTT method. Cellular morphologic changes were observed under an inverted phase contrast microscope. The cell condition was observed with Hoechst 33342 and PI staining. Generation of reactive oxygen species and cell membrane potential were detected as well. The cell cycles were analyzed with lfow cytometry. The expressions of apoptosis-related proteins Bcl-2 and Bax were measured by Western blot assay.Results:The result indicates that isosteviol suppressed the growth of U-2OS cells in time- and concentration-dependent manner. Isosteviol could cause S phase cell cycle arrest at 24 h and apoptosis at 48 h. With the increased drug concentration, reactive oxygen species increased significantly, and the membrane potential gradually reduced. In addition, isosteviol treatment enhanced the expression of Bax but reduced that of Bcl-2.Conclusion:The inhibition of isosteviol on cell growth of U-2OS cells was possibly caused by promoting apoptosis through regulating the apoptosis-related protein expressions, such as the enhancement of Bax and reduction of Bcl-2 expression.
8.Age related reference value for reticulocyte hemoglobin equivalent among children aged one to thirteen years
Yuefang WANG ; Hui YANG ; Xia WANG ; Juan LI ; Lan CHEN ; Hong WANG ; Qi CHEN ; Yongmei JIANG
Chinese Journal of Laboratory Medicine 2008;31(7):767-770
Objective To establish age related reference value for the new reticulocyte hemoglobin equivalent (RET-He) parameter in healthy children aged one to thirteen years. Methods Reticulocyte hemoglobin equivalent was measured by Sysmex XE-2100 after completing daily internal quality control in 424 healthy children and the outlying observations was handled afterward, Age related reference value anddistribution of RET-He level were described as the 2.5th and 97.5th centiles, and the equation regardingage related reference value was established through curve fitting methods. Results After grouping accordingto sex, the medians of boys and girls in RET-He were 31.30 pg,31.80 pg. Non-parametric test showed therewas no differences between the boys and girls. When the data from two group was integrated together, thefitted equations of RET-He were: P2.5 =-0.008X3+0.125X2 - 0.178X+26.456; P97.5= 0.021X2-0.184X+34.670(X refers to age) ; R2 were 0.85 and 0.90,respectively(P <0.05). There was statisticallysignificance for the above equations. Conclusions The reference value of RET-He in healthy children isdifferent from those in adult. The equations can be used to produce age related reference value. It could beuseful for anemia diagnosis, differential diagnosis and hematopoiesis screening at early stage.
9.Evaluation of early emergency care process for severe pelvic fractures combined with multiple trauma
Jian LU ; Yongbing QIAN ; Feng XIA ; Kanglong YU ; Ruilan WANG ; Yongmei CHE
Chinese Journal of Trauma 2012;28(4):296-300
Objective To evaluate the early emergency management process for severe pelvic fractures combined with multiple trauma. Methods The study involved 113 patients with severe pelvic fractures combined with multiple trauma treated from January 2007 to May 2011.The patients were divided into two groups,ie,before trauma team establishment (26 patients treated from January 2007 to May 2008) and after trauma team establishment (87 patients treated from June 2008 to May 2011 ) in accordance with the establishment period of trauma team in June 2008.The mortality was compared before and after application of trauma-team-based algorithm with damage control resuscitation,external fixation and angiographic embolization.Variables including age and gender distribution,ISS score,injury type and mechanism,transportation time,associated injury number,initial systolic pressure hemoglobin and blood transfusion were analyzed for study of their relation with mortality. Results After trauma team establishment,the mortality (23%) was significantly lower than before trauma team establishment (46%).The mortality showed significant relation to ISSN score and over two regions of associated injury,but showed no correlation with age and gender distribution,injury type and mechanism,transportation time initial systolic pressure hemoglobin,and blood transfusion. Conclusion The application of trauma team is effective in treatment of severe pelvic fractures combined with multiple trauma and can decrease the mortality.
10.Effects of Naotaifang on Expression of MMP-9, NF-κB and TIMP-1 after Focal Cerebral Ischemia in Rats
Jun LIAO ; Wei ZHANG ; Xing XIA ; Yongmei SHI ; An CHEN ; Jinwen GE
Chinese Journal of Information on Traditional Chinese Medicine 2013;(9):28-30
Objective To observe effects of Naotaifang on MMP-9, NF-κB and TIMP-1 after focal cerebral ischemia in rats. Methods The rats were randomly divided into sham operation group, model group, and Naotaifang low- (3 g/kg), medium- (9 g/kg), high- dose (27 g/kg) group. After 3 days of corresponding therapy by intragastric administration once a day, the regional cerebral ischemia model was made by middle cerebral artery occlusion (MCAO) with suture method. Following 3 days, the rats were treated with previous method. On the third day, hippocampal C2 region of ischemic tissue was detected by HE dyeing. And the contents of MMP-9, NF-κB and TIMP1 proteins in hippocampal C2 region were measured by immunohistochemical method. Results The number of normal brain cells in high dose group of Naotaifang was more than that of the model group, and only a few cells appeared nucleus pycnosis. The MMP-9 expression of all dose groups of Naotaifang were significantly decreased than model group (P<0.05). The NF-κB expression of high and medium dose groups of Naotaifang were significantly decreased (P<0.05). The TIMP1 expression of all dose groups of Naotaifang were significantly increased compared with sham operation group (P<0.05). Conclusion The mechanism of Naotaifang protecting blood brain barrier against injury of cerebral ischemia may be involved in ameliorating MMP, NF-κB and increasing TIMP1 expression.
